這篇“CSS中translate實現(xiàn)水平垂直居中效果的方法”除了程序員外大部分人都不太理解,今天小編為了讓大家更加理解“CSS中translate實現(xiàn)水平垂直居中效果的方法”,給大家總結了以下內(nèi)容,具有一定借鑒價值,內(nèi)容詳細步驟清晰,細節(jié)處理妥當,希望大家通過這篇文章有所收獲,下面讓我們一起來看看具體內(nèi)容吧。
為靜樂等地區(qū)用戶提供了全套網(wǎng)頁設計制作服務,及靜樂網(wǎng)站建設行業(yè)解決方案。主營業(yè)務為成都做網(wǎng)站、成都網(wǎng)站制作、靜樂網(wǎng)站設計,以傳統(tǒng)方式定制建設網(wǎng)站,并提供域名空間備案等一條龍服務,秉承以專業(yè)、用心的態(tài)度為用戶提供真誠的服務。我們深信只要達到每一位用戶的要求,就會得到認可,從而選擇與我們長期合作。這樣,我們也可以走得更遠!translate(-50%,-50%) 屬性:
向上和左,移動自身長寬的 50%,使其居于中心位置。
與使用margin實現(xiàn)居中不同的是,margin必須知道自身的寬高,而translate可以在不知道寬高的情況下進行居中,tranlate函數(shù)中的百分比是相對于自身寬高的百分比
(使用top和left為50%時,以窗口左上角為原點)。
示例:
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<meta http-equiv="X-UA-Compatible" content="ie=edge"> <title>Document</title> <style media="screen"> .container { position: relative; width: 50%; } .container img { width: 100%; display: block; height: auto; } .overlay { width: 100%; height: 100%; position: absolute; left: 0; top: 0; right: 0; bottom: 0; opacity: 0; transition: 0.5s ease; background: rgb(0, 0, 0); } .container:hover .overlay { opacity: 0.5; } .text { color: white; font-size: 20px; position: absolute; top: 50%; left: 50%; transform: translate(-50%, -50%); -ms-transform: translate(-50%, -50%); } </style> </head> <body> <h3>淡入效果</h3> <div class="container"> <img src="./img/photo2.jpg" alt="Avatar" class="image"> <div class="overlay"> <div class="text">Hello World</div> </div> </div> </body> </html>
效果:
感謝你的閱讀,希望你對“CSS中translate實現(xiàn)水平垂直居中效果的方法”這一關鍵問題有了一定的理解,具體使用情況還需要大家自己動手實驗使用過才能領會,快去試試吧,如果想閱讀更多相關知識點的文章,歡迎關注創(chuàng)新互聯(lián)行業(yè)資訊頻道!
本文標題:CSS中translate實現(xiàn)水平垂直居中效果的方法-創(chuàng)新互聯(lián)
本文網(wǎng)址:http://aaarwkj.com/article2/pjhoc.html
成都網(wǎng)站建設公司_創(chuàng)新互聯(lián),為您提供做網(wǎng)站、全網(wǎng)營銷推廣、自適應網(wǎng)站、移動網(wǎng)站建設、微信公眾號、外貿(mào)建站
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)
猜你還喜歡下面的內(nèi)容